Job description

Valley Services is a family owned residential and construction solutions provider, conveniently located in the heart of downtown San Jose. It consists of three divisions: the transfer station, rental toilets, fencing and dumpsters. At Valley Services you won’t just have a job, but you will be a part of an amazing team that is contributing to the growth of Silicon Valley. By joining the Valley Team you will become a member of the family.

As a Class A Outbound Driver, you will be a key member in timely transporting materials from one location to another.

We are looking for a licensed driver who will work closely with our team of dispatchers in order to plan routes. A Class A license is required for this position.

Responsibilities include but not limited to:
  • Perform daily pre- and post-trip inspections. Complete and submit vehicle reports at the end of each shift
  • Safely load, secure, and unload drivers' waste.
  • Drive semi-trailers/tractor-trailers and operate walking-floor trucks along designated roads to designated landfills.
  • Maneuver the truck in a safe manner while on the road and around the facility.
  • Operate Class A vehicles to tow trailers; must be competent with air brake lines and gladhand connectors
  • Clean loose trash off the truck and or ground around a truck that spills during the loading and unloading process to maintain a clean vehicle and surrounding area.
  • Clean waste debris from the truck body on each run to ensure that equipment operation will continue safely and productively.
  • Courteously interact with customers or the general public along the route and answer questions or respond to requests.
  • Drive through commercial scales when required per DOT regulations.
  • Notify the supervisor of issues requiring management action.
  • Maintain and submit a DOT logbook, daily route/productivity sheet, and vehicle condition report (post-trip inspection sheet).
  • Safely drive and unload the End Dump truck to ensure all materials are transported safely and effectively.
Requirements
Skills/ Abilities and Knowledge (but not limited to)
  • CDL Class A, No air Brake Restriction
  • Two years or equivalent commercial truck driving experience
  • in the most recent 36-month period, as verified by a current MVR/driver abstract:
  • No more than one moving violation or accident
  • No suspensions or revocation due to a moving violation or accident
  • No DUI (driving under the influence) convictions
  • Must demonstrate the ability to maneuver truck and trailer into and out of minimum clearance spaces, using mirrors to back distances up to approximately 120 feet. Able to use a key map and GPS to locate service addresses and landfills
  • Must demonstrate the ability to connect, disconnect, and tow a trailer safely
  • Able to follow safe operating practices, including lockout/ tag out procedures to ensure trick is inoperative when working in the truck body
  • Monitor operations to detect loose debris, using mirrors or direct sight and or listening for debris falling onto the truck during pickup and delivery operation. Visually scan customer site before and after pick up and delivery. Able to follow safe operating practices.
  • Able to learn and use interpersonal skills relating to good customer service
  • Ability to read, write, and comprehend the reports well enough to accurately complete daily assignments
Physical Requirements (but not limited to)
  • Walking, bending, climbing, crouching, driving, sitting & twisting
  • Visually inspection around and under the truck and its components
  • Able to lift at least seventy- five (75) pounds as needed daily
  • Stamina and flexibility to maintain a steady work pace
  • Reaching
  • Pushing/Pulling
  • Gripping/ grasping controls
  • Able to effectively communicate with dispatch/ supervisors
